  • Patent number: 7159107
    Abstract: A booting method capable of executing a warm boot or a cold boot when a CPU crash occurs in a computer system having a CPU and a memory. First, when the CPU is in a crash state, it is detected that a user wants to execute a hardware reset function or a software reset function. Next, a hardware reset operation is executed to reboot the CPU. Then, when the user chooses to execute the hardware reset function, data and predefined values of the memory are deleted to make the computer system return to a default state. Thereafter, when the user chooses to execute the software reset function, the hardware reset operation is regarded as an operation to replace a software reset operation, and the computer system holds the data and predefined values to make the computer system return to a setting state before the computer system is crashed.

  • Patent number: 7133918
    Abstract: A method for an HTML document to access local system resources, which receives an HTTP request and judges whether the HTTP request includes a predetermined keyword. A system-resource-accessing portion of the HTTP request is processed when the HTTP request includes the predetermined keyword. Then, the HTTP request is checked whether it contains a Referer field. If the header of the HTTP request includes the Referer field, the HTTP request will be treated as an external request, and the local system resource accessing will be denied even when the HTTP request includes the predetermined keyword.

  • Patent number: 7127277
    Abstract: A handheld electronic device comprises a shiftable pivot structure (230) interconnecting a flip cover (210) to a base (220) of the device. The base has a pivotal accommodation groove (224) and the flip cover has a pivot sleeve (212). The shiftable pivot structure comprises a sliding axle (240) slideably fitted in the pivotal accommodation groove. The shiftable pivot structure is hinged to the pivot sleeve. When the flip cover is closed, the pivot sleeve of the flip cover can be moved to be hidden within the pivotal accommodation groove to get protection and to keep the appearance of the device neat. For communication, the flip cover needs to be opened, which is accomplished by firstly shifting the pivot sleeve and the sliding axle outwardly to a position in which the pivot sleeve protrudes from the pivotal accommodation groove, and then pivoting the flip cover relative to the base to an open position.

  • Patent number: 7105752
    Abstract: A method and apparatus for avoiding pressing inaccuracies on a touch panel. The touch panel includes a panel, a control module having an analog-to-digital converter (ADC) and a delay buffer, and a processor, the delay buffer able to buffer a trigger signal for interrupting the processor. The method includes sequentially receiving a plurality of analog signals generated by the panel when the panel is touched with the control module, transforming the plurality of analog signals into a plurality of corresponding digital signals and transmitting the plurality of digital signals to the processor with the analog-to-digital converter, neglecting a first m digital signals of the plurality of digital signals, and neglecting a last n digital signals of the plurality of digital signals, where m and n are integers with values equal to or larger than 1.

  • Patent number: 7106304
    Abstract: A keypad device including a parallel/serial conversion device, a keypad module, and a controller coupled to the parallel/serial conversion device and the keypad module. The keys in the keypad module are arranged in parallel. After the key is triggered, an interrupt signal will be fed to the controller. On receiving the interrupt signal, the controller will feed a drive voltage to the keypad module generating a parallel signal therein. After causing the parallel/serial conversion device to read and store the parallel signal, the controller will be able to read the parallel signal serially by using the clock signals. The status of the keypad module can thereby be obtained.

  • Patent number: 7057561
    Abstract: A multi-frequency antenna includes a antenna body, a patch antenna, and a ground plane. The antenna body has first and second radiation arms, a feed-in terminal, and a ground terminal disposed in one side of the antenna body for signal feeding, and grounding. The first and second radiation arms are arranged in a symmetrically inward spiral structure. Two current paths with different lengths are created, along with the two radiation arms from the feed-in terminal, and thereby the antenna is operable at two frequencies. An additional patch antenna can be disposed beside the antenna body to allow the antenna to have more operational frequencies. In practice, the length of the patch antenna can be designed according to the bandwidth of Bluetooth signals to meet the requirement of Bluetooth communication. The ground plane is disposed beneath the antenna body and the patch antenna for the purpose of grounding of the antenna's signals.

  • Patent number: 7023430
    Abstract: An electronic device has a cavity in which a stylus can be slidably inserted. The stylus has a retaining slot thereon. Being inserted in the cavity, the stylus firstly pushes a retainer to be moved resiliently. The stylus further presses on a stylus-releasing device that terminates the cavity, thereby engaging the stylus-releasing device in a stable configuration with a resilient force. Meanwhile the retainer inserts into the retaining slot of the stylus to hold and immobilize the stylus in the cavity. To extract the stylus, a short pressing action is exerted on the stylus, which disengages the stylus-releasing device from the stable configuration, thereby the stylus-releasing device exerts a resilient force on the stylus that is ejected partially out of the cavity to facilitate a grasp of the stylus.
